Course Content

• Introduction to Hybrid Materials in Construction
• Sustainable and Green Hybrid Materials: Lifecycle Assessment & Environmental Impact
• Mechanical Properties of Hybrid Composites for Construction
• Design and Modelling of Hybrid Material Structures
• Fabrication and Manufacturing Techniques for Hybrid Composites
• Case Studies: Successful Applications of Hybrid Materials in Buildings
• Durability and Performance of Hybrid Materials in Extreme Conditions
• Advanced Characterization Techniques for Hybrid Materials
• Cost Analysis and Life Cycle Costing of Hybrid Construction
• Health and Safety Aspects of Hybrid Material Handling and Construction

Career Role Description
Senior Hybrid Materials Engineer (Construction) Leads research, development, and implementation of innovative hybrid materials in large-scale construction projects. Requires extensive experience in material science and project management.
Hybrid Materials Specialist (Civil Engineering) Focuses on the application of hybrid materials in civil engineering projects, including bridges, tunnels, and pavements. Expertise in structural analysis and material performance is crucial.
Research Scientist - Advanced Composites & Hybrid Materials Conducts research and development on new hybrid materials, focusing on improving durability, sustainability, and cost-effectiveness in construction. Strong analytical and laboratory skills are needed.
Construction Project Manager (Hybrid Materials) Oversees the implementation of hybrid materials in construction projects, ensuring quality, safety, and adherence to specifications. Strong project management and communication skills are essential.
